What is the typical style of prayer and worship at your Orthodox synagogue?

Our synagogue follows traditional Orthodox Jewish practices for prayer and worship. This includes separate seating areas for men and women, as well as the use of Hebrew liturgy and melodies. Our services are led by a rabbi and cantor, and we also have regular Torah readings and holiday celebrations.

Are there separate seating areas or sections for men and women during services?

Yes, we have separate seating areas for men and women during services. This is in keeping with traditional Orthodox Jewish practices, which emphasize modesty and separation of genders during religious activities.
